Ordinals
beta
Address 1Ey3L5EniRnfhkNsg2HdjdmNTcWcxt78L7
sat balance
5095473
outputs
6062d50f420c2c9ee84dd31e16d6ae99be9e2d67293c5d569e84aa70d782f5f9:0